National Talent Search Examination (NTSE) is an offline scholarship exam for class 10 students to encourage higher studies in the field of Science and Social science. This exam is conducted by NCERT at two stages. SCERT or other authority of the respective state conducts stage 1 at the state level and stage 2 exam is held by NCERT at the national level. NTSE stands for National Talent Search Examination and it is conducted by NCERT in two stages. It is an offline scholarship exam for class 10th students to encourage higher studies in the field of Science and Social science.
First stage is conducted at state level by SCERT of respective state under the authorization of NCERT and second stage is conducted by NCERT itself at national level and in stage 2 only those candidates appear who qualify stage 1.
It is useful for class 10th candidates who will be pursuing class 11th and 12th after passing class 10th and seeking financial assistance for class 11th an d12th.
